Why is U2's 2002 Super Bowl halftime show leading against Kendrick Lamar's 2025 performance?

U2's 2002 show resonates deeply with fans, partly because it was a powerful tribute to the victims of 9/11. The emotional impact and historical significance of that performance still tug at the heartstrings, giving it a solid edge over newer shows.
